1. Choosing the Location
The first step in constructing a fort is selecting an appropriate location for your fort. It is recommended that you choose a high ground because it puts you at an advantage over your enemies. Once you have selected your ideal spot, clear out any obstacles that may hinder your fort’s construction. Doing this will ensure that your fort will not be obstructed by natural elements, thus weakening its defense system.
After clearing the space, gather materials such as dirt or sand to flatten out the area where the fort will be built. This process not only enhances the fort’s stability but also gives it a beautiful appearance.
2. Building the Walls
The next crucial step is building the walls, get Minecraft bricks or blocks to construct them into a structure that will provide cover from enemies. You can also use cobblestones, wooden planks, or any other material that you prefer. When building your walls, ensure that they are three blocks high, giving adequate space to stand and shoot from inside the fort.
If you intend to use glass blocks to enhance your structure’s aesthetics, you should note that it will make your fortress more vulnerable since it cannot withstand explosions.
3. Constructing Defensive Mechanisms
One essential feature of any successful fort is its ability to defend against attacks. As such, it’s vital to install defense mechanisms to keep enemies at bay. A moat is a great option to keep opposing forces at bay. It is essential to dig the moat as deep as possible to impede the advancement of any intruder.
You can also install hidden trapdoors or levers inside the fort, which you can trigger to trap intruders or launch a surprise attack. Moreover, placing defensive mechanisms such as TNT cannons, lava traps, and potion dispensers adds additional protection to your fortress.
